Saturday Caterwaul: Panthers GameDay Open Forum

Florida forward Shawn Matthias has struggled offensively as much as any of his teammates in recent games, going pointless over the last three since scoring against Ottawa on February 15. His numbers for the season appear to favor meetings with Saturday night’s opponent, however: 2G/1A, plus-3 and a gamewinner in 2 matches vs the Hurricanes. Career against Carolina? 8 points (4G) in 13 games; not too lousy for a third (and at times, fourth) line center.

Panthers Playoff Update:

Why tonight is a Big Deal in SoFla, beyond the obvious:

Focusing on clubs within 6 points of Panthers (66P); teams FLA needs to lose in bold

  • STL at WPG (67P), 2 p.m.; you know the drill here
  • WSH (65P) at TOR (65P), 7; either club winning in regulation is technically fine, but we’re traveling the Win The Division route and siding with the Leafs
  • BUF (61P) at NYR, 7; Gotta admit: Sabres caught me off-guard here/
